개발

[Git] Pull, merge (Intellij) 본문

GIT

[Git] Pull, merge (Intellij)

Dev.hs 2022. 5. 26. 01:24

pull 시에 충돌과 병합에대해 알아보자.

PULL

pull 사용시 원격저장소의 내용을 가져와 로컬데이터와 병합을 하게 된다.

시나리오

  • A사용자가 Test.class를 수정한뒤 푸쉬했다.
  • B사용자도 Test.class를 수정한 상태이다. 서로 같은 라인을 수정했으며 pull을 했으며 충돌이 나온 상태.

과정

B사용자가 Pull 할경우 나오는 메세지

pull into ‘main’ Using Merge를 이용하자.

클릭시 바로 MergeTool을 보여줌.

충돌을 잡고 apply하면 변경됐을 경우 다음처럼 변경사항에서 확인된것을 볼 수 있음.

'GIT' 카테고리의 다른 글

[Git] gitIgnore 안될때 (Intellij)  (0) 2022.05.30
[Git] Fetch,Merge (Intellij)  (0) 2022.05.21
[Git] Push,Merge (Intellij)  (0) 2022.05.21
[GIT] 서브모듈  (0) 2021.11.17
Comments